What Is Companionship Care?

How we can help:

 

At Melksham Homecare, we understand that emotional wellbeing is just as important as physical care. Companionship and emotional support play a vital role in helping people feel connected, valued, and supported in everyday life.

 

Our companionship services are designed to reduce loneliness, build confidence, and provide reassurance through friendly, reliable presence — always delivered with kindness, respect, and genuine care.

 

Whether support is needed for a few hours a week or as part of ongoing care, we tailor our companionship services to individual interests, routines, and preferences.
 

Who Is It For?

Companionship care is ideal for older adults who live alone, feel isolated, or simply want more social interaction. It’s also a great option for families who want peace of mind knowing their loved one has regular, caring company.

Our Companionship & Emotional Support Services Include:


💜 Friendly conversation and regular visits
Providing meaningful companionship, shared conversation, and a familiar face.

 

💜 Emotional support and reassurance
Offering encouragement, listening, and understanding during difficult or lonely times.

 

💜 Support with hobbies and interests
Including puzzles, games, gardening, reading, or creative activities.

 

💜 Accompaniment to appointments or social outings
Helping individuals stay connected to their community and attend events with confidence.

 

💜 Light household tasks and shared activities
Such as meal preparation, tidying, or enjoying a cup of tea together.

 

💜 Support to maintain routines and independence
Encouraging confidence and engagement while respecting personal choice.

 

💜 Calm, reassuring presence from familiar caregivers
Building trust through consistent, compassionate support.
